News: Adblock will interfere with your expiernce, Kindly consider disabling your adblock on our website.

Too Much TV - (S01E18)


Wondering what to watch this weekend? Look no further. Too Much TV tells you everything you need to know about what's on telly.

Episode Title: Episode 18
Airs: 2016-03-23 at 18:30